State lawmakers pass Anthony Gillan Act to protect injured firefighters

VIDEO: A bill inspired by a North Central Florida firefighter injured during training has been approved by the Florida Legislature. The Anthony Gillan Act, named after a Marion County fire captain, was approved by the state House unanimously on Tuesday afternoon. The bill would provide benefits to firefighters injured during training exercises. A companion bill has already been approved in the state Senate.
